- The distance between Tarauaca, Brazil and Grants Pass, Or, Usa is approximately 7,692 km or 4,780 mi.
- To reach Tarauaca in this distance one would set out from Grants Pass, Or bearing 123.2°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tarauaca bearing 141.1° or SE .
- Tarauaca has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Grants Pass, Or has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Tarauaca is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Grants Pass, Or is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 12 °C (21.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.9 °C (28.6°F) less in Tarauaca.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1399.2 mm (55.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1399.2 l/m² (34.34 US gal/ft²) or 13,992,000 l/ha (1,495,838 US gal/ac) more. About 2 7/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.4° higher in Tarauaca than in Grants Pass, Or.
